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

What fence height and style fits my space? Consider local regulations, yard layout, and whether you prefer a solid panel look or slat-based privacy that allows airflow.

What materials best suit your climate? Metal posts offer durability, but aluminum is lightweight; composite panels resist weathering with less maintenance than real wood.

How important is easy installation? For DIY projects, look for no-dig or slide-in designs that enable solo setup, even if some parts require basic tools.

What is the total cost of ownership? Consider initial cost, replacement slats, maintenance needs, and potential future upgrades like gates or extended panels.

Are you aiming for a specific aesthetic? Wood tones and wood-grain finishes provide warmth, while metal or aluminum posts deliver a modern, minimal look.
